About

Dr. Suash Deb is a prominent researcher in computational intelligence, with a primary focus on metaheuristic optimization algorithms and their applications in robotics and engineering. His seminal work, "A review of metaheuristics in robotics" (2015), which has garnered over 60 citations, provides a comprehensive synthesis of how nature-inspired algorithms—such as particle swarm optimization and genetic algorithms—are revolutionizing autonomous systems and robotic path planning. This review has become a foundational resource for researchers seeking to bridge the gap between optimization theory and practical robotic control. Beyond this, Dr. Deb has made significant contributions to the development of novel metaheuristic frameworks, often emphasizing their efficiency in solving complex, real-world problems.
